Job Description

We are currently seeking motivated and detail-oriented individuals to join our team as Remote Booking & Scheduling Coordinators. In this role, you will support clients by coordinating appointments, managing reservations, and ensuring all details are handled accurately from start to finish.

This fully remote position is ideal for someone who enjoys working behind the scenes, staying organized, and communicating clearly while managing multiple tasks. You'll play a key role in keeping schedules on track and ensuring a smooth, well-coordinated experience for clients.

Training and ongoing support are provided, but success in this role requires strong time management, independence, and attention to detail.

What You'll Do:

  • Coordinate bookings, schedules, and confirmations
  • Communicate with clients to gather information and provide updates
  • Review and track details to ensure accuracy and timely completion
  • Follow up on outstanding items to keep everything on schedule
  • Provide professional and friendly support throughout the process
